Description
The Blackmagic Video Assist 7” 12G HDR is a professional monitor and recorder in one, for making film productions. The 7-inch screen has a display with a resolution of 1920 x 1200 pixels and a brightness of 2500 cd/m². That means that you will always be able to see the display, no matter what the light circumstances. With HDMI or 12G-SDI, you can record video from various cameras. The Blackmagic Video Assist records HDR video at a resolution of 4K DCO, 4K UHDm 2K, or HD in 10-bit 4:2:2. The filest are Apple ProRes by default, but also available in DNxHD and DNxHR coding.
3D LUT support makes it possible to monitor shots with the desired colour and look. Record video with two UHS-II SD cards, or directly via USB-C to an external hard drive. The fast touch screen makes working with the Blackmagic Video Assist very pleasant. Various settings including histogram, waveform, RGB parade, vector scope, zebra, peaking, etc. are easily activated. A little light at the top of the monitor indicates that it's recording.
